A nurse is reviewing the medical record of a client who has schizophrenia.
Which of the following should the nurse report to the provider?
Exhibit 1
Blood pressure: 102/56
mm Hg. Heart rate: 95/min
Respiratory rate:
18/min Temperature:
37.4C (99.3F)


Exhibit 2
Medication Administration Record Clozapine 150 mg PO
twice daily Benztropine 0.5 mg PO twice daily as needed
for tremors.


Exhibit 3
Nurse's notes: Client reports feeling dizzy when changing positions,
Reports weight gain of 1kg (2.2 lb.) in the past month. Also reports a sore
throat for the past 3 days and dry mouth. Client ate 75% of breakfast and
reports slightly nauseous.


A. Dietary

,NURSING 10 ATI EXIT EXAM Questions and Answers
Latest Update 2026/2027 Graded A+
intake B.
Heart rate.
C. Sore throat.
D. Blood pressure - ANSWER C. Sore throat.

A nurse is providing discharge teaching for a client who has an implantable
cardioverter defibrillator which of the following statements demonstrates

, NURSING 10 ATI EXIT EXAM Questions and Answers
Latest Update 2026/2027 Graded A+
understanding of the teaching?


A. "I will soak in the tub rather and
showering" B. "I will wear loose clothing
around my ICD"
C. "I will stop using my microwave oven at home because of my ICD"
D. "I can hold my cellphone on the same side of my body as the ICD" -
ANSWER B. "I will wear loose clothing around my ICD"


A nurse is caring for a client who is at 14 weeks gestation and reports
feelings of ambivalence about being pregnant. Which of the following
responses should the nurse make?


A. "Describe your feelings to me about being pregnant"

B. "You should discuss your feelings about being pregnant with
your provider" C. "Have you discussed these feelings with your
partner?"
D. "When did you start having these feelings?" - ANSWER A. "Describe your
feelings to me about being pregnant"
